Edition 102 Of iDiski Times Is Out Now

Edition 102 of iDiski Times is out now and available for FREE at participating Shoprite stores.

With this weekend’s Nedbank Cup semi-finals seeing Kaizer Chiefs take on Orlando Pirates, Velile Mnyandu caught up with Chiefs midfielder Siyethemba Sithebe to talk about the game, his teammates and life at Naturena.

William Twala, played for both Chiefs and Pirates, and the winger is back in South Africa after three years abroad. Lethabo Kganyago spoke to Twala about his time in Asia, and about his future.

Sinethemba Makonco brings us an interview with another former Pirates player, Sifiso Myeni, who is now playing for VTM in Botswana. Myeni tells Makonco how he almost joined Chiefs before he started his career at Wits.

Meanwhile, in another exclusive interview, Lethabo spoke to Racing Louisville and Banyana Banyana star Thembi Kgatlana, who is getting fit after sitting out for almost a year. 

We also have a feature on Mamelodi Sundowns striker Peter Shalulile, who was recently honoured after scoring his 100th top-flight career goal in South African football.

Our coaching guru Moritz Kossmann is back with another edition of The Drawing Board and this week, Moritz talks about One vs one attacking.

Of course, we also have our weekly contribution from our friends at iDiskiTV, as Junior Khanye, Tso Vilakazi and Nkululeko Nkewu look back at the weekend’s action.

There’s still news about Black Leopards’ relegation, Eric Tinkler’s frustrations with SAFA, the latest rumours, and much more in this week’s edition…
